An Irish company has beaten off international competition to win the prize for Best Animation at the children's British Academy of Film and Television Awards.
The Dublin company - Moving Still Productions - took the award for 'Sir Gawain and the Green Knight', based on an episode in the fable of King Arthur and the Round Table.
'Monsters Inc' won Best Film at the awards ceremony held at the Hilton Hotel in London.
'SM:tv', ITV's Saturday morning show, won best entertainment show for a third year.
The show is currently presented by Irishman and 'Big Brother' winner Brian Dowling and Tess Daly. It also won the Lego/Bafta Kids Vote award, chosen by viewers.
